The Prodromus of Nicolaus Steno's Dissertation: Concerning a Solid Body Enclosed by Process of Nature Within a Solid is a book written by Nicolaus Steno and published in 1916. The book is a translation of Steno's original work, which was written in Latin in the 17th century. The dissertation explores the concept of how solid bodies can be formed within other solid bodies through natural processes. Steno was a Danish scientist and theologian who made significant contributions to the fields of anatomy, geology, and paleontology. In this work, he presents a detailed analysis of the formation of solid bodies and provides evidence to support his theories.
